WebFeb 10, 2024 · Reactivity decreases. The most reactive metals are on the bottom left side of the periodic table. Atoms lose electrons less easily to form cations. Metals become less likely to oxidize, tarnish, or corrode. Less energy is needed to isolate the metallic elements from their compounds. The metals become weaker electron donors or reducing agents.
